Friday’s game: Sandy Alcantara, trying to nail down a spot in the Marlins starting rotation, couldn’t get his former batterymat­e out in a 4-2 loss to the Cardinals at Roger Dean Chevrolet Stadium. Yadier Molina, who caught the promising right-hander when he debuted last September with St. Louis, had three hits off him including a long home run. Molina also singled off Alcantara and just missed another homer with a drive off the top of the fence in left. Molina’s double, which followed Tommy Pham’s leadoff triple in the fifth, ended Alcantara’s bid to complete five innings. He allowed three runs and six hits while walking three and striking out four. He threw 74 pitches, 47 for strikes. Molina homered off a 95-mph fastball that was up. “I have no idea how he got his hands out that fast and got the barrel on it,” said Alcantara, acquired in the trade for Marcell Ozuna, who had a double past third base. But Alcantara got his breaking ball working over his last two innings and had a stretch with three consecutiv­e strikeouts. “The thing with the breaking ball is we want him to get his arm going and throw it. I thought as the game went on, his breaking ball got better,” said manager Don Mattingly, adding his assessment of Alcantara’s camp. “I think he’s been pretty good. Obviously, a lot has been thrown on him with the trade and everything, but I think he’s handled everything really well.” ... Molina, who drove in three of the Cardinals runs, had four hits and got his second homer of the day in the seventh off Junichi Tazawa . ... Derek Dietrich hit his team-leading third homer for Miami, a towering drive to right off Michael Wacha. That was the only run Wacha allowed in six innings.
